CHENNAI: Chinese mobiles manufacturer Oppo Mobiles has launched a selfie-focused smartphone, A57 that runs on Anroid 6.0 Marshmallow in Chennai on Thursday. The smartphone is priced at `14,990.
The A57 has a 16 megapixel camera at the front with f2.0 aperture and Oppo’s beautify 4.0 software for visual enhancements. Other features include palm shutter that takes a picture after you hold your hand in front of the camera and effects for blurring the background.

“When we saw the demand for the great 16 MP selfie camera on the F1s, we set out to bring that experience to an even wider range of users, said Sky Li, vice-president of Oppo and managing director of international mobile business and President of Oppo India. The A57 brings consumers advanced features, that goes beyond the conventional boundaries for this price segment, he added.
Apart from that, the A57 has a 13 megapixel rear camera with f2.2 aperture, 5.2-inch 720p IPS LCD, Qualcomm Snapdragon 435 processor, 3GB RAM, 32GB expandable storage and 2900mAh battery.
